    Before we get into the nitty-gritty of Pope Francis net worth, let’s take a step back and understand who this man really is. Pope Francis, born Jorge Mario Bergoglio on December 17, 1936, in Buenos Aires, Argentina, is the first pope from the Americas and the first Jesuit pope. His journey to the papacy is nothing short of remarkable.

    Early Life and Background

    Pope Francis grew up in a middle-class family. His father was an accountant, and his mother was a housewife. From a young age, he showed a deep interest in spirituality and eventually joined the Society of Jesus, also known as the Jesuits. His early years were marked by dedication to education and service, laying the foundation for the leader he would become.

    Rise to Prominence

    Before becoming pope, Jorge Bergoglio served as the Archbishop of Buenos Aires. During his tenure, he was known for his simple lifestyle and commitment to social justice. He often took public transportation and lived in a small apartment, setting a precedent for the humble approach he would later embody as pope.

    Does Pope Francis Have Personal Wealth?

    Now, let’s address the elephant in the room: Does Pope Francis have personal wealth? The short answer is no. As a man of the cloth, Pope Francis has taken vows of poverty, chastity, and obedience. Any financial assets he may have had before becoming pope were likely donated to the church or used for charitable purposes.

    But here’s the thing: while Pope Francis himself may not have personal wealth, the Vatican, the organization he leads, is a different story. The Vatican is one of the wealthiest religious institutions in the world, with investments, real estate, and art collections that are worth billions.

  • The Vatican’s Financial Empire

    The Vatican’s financial empire is vast and complex. It includes properties, banks, and investments spread across the globe. The Vatican Bank, officially known as the Institute for the Works of Religion (IOR), manages the financial assets of the Catholic Church. While the exact figures are not always transparent, estimates suggest that the Vatican’s wealth could be in the billions of dollars.

    Pope Francis’ Commitment to Humility

    One of the defining characteristics of Pope Francis is his commitment to humility. Unlike some of his predecessors, he chooses to live a modest life. Instead of residing in the grand Apostolic Palace, he stays in a simple guesthouse within the Vatican. He also prefers to use public transportation and has been known to take buses and trains, even as pope.

    The Vatican’s Financial Challenges

    While the Vatican is undoubtedly wealthy, it also faces financial challenges. In recent years, there have been reports of financial scandals and mismanagement within the Vatican. Pope Francis has taken steps to address these issues, implementing reforms to ensure transparency and accountability.

    Efforts to Reform Vatican Finances

    Pope Francis has appointed financial experts to oversee the Vatican’s finances and ensure that they are managed responsibly. He has also established new regulations to combat corruption and improve financial transparency.
